Kinetic Automation is pioneering the development of a network of automated repair centers tailored for modern vehicles. Our mission is to establish Kinetic as the premier infrastructure-as-a-service provider by servicing vehicles through our robotic repair centers, fueled by our cutting-edge software and AI technology.
We specialize in delivering precise calibration service to ensure the utmost performance and safety of vehicle Advanced Driver Assistance Systems (ADAS).
Our unwavering dedication to innovation and client satisfaction has solidified Kinetic Automation as the trusted partner for automotive manufacturers, collision centers, dealerships, and service centers.

Job Duties
- Drive robotic engineering design, development, and testing of autonomous vehicle systems and technologies.
- Manage the coordination and overall integration of technical activities in engineering projects.
- Guide the development and implementation of SLAM (simultaneous localization and mapping) algorithms tailored for autonomous vehicles.
- Oversee the integration of machine learning models into the robotic systems, ensuring optimal performance and reliability.
- Direct, review, and approve project design changes.
- Monitor the latest advancements in SLAM, machine learning, and robotics, and incorporate them into the company's technology stack.
- Ensure the robustness, safety, and efficiency of the developed systems.
- Lead the testing and validation of the autonomous systems in real-world scenarios.
- Assess project feasibility by analyzing technology, resource needs, or market demand.
- Collaborate with academic and industry partners to drive advancements in the field of autonomous vehicles.
- Lead the testing and validation of robotic systems, ensuring they meet safety and performance standards.
- Collaborate with the quality assurance team to develop testing protocols and computing methodologies.
- Develop and manage the engineering budget, ensuring optimal allocation of resources for projects and initiatives.
- Develop and implement policies, standards, and procedures for engineering and technical work.
- Establish scientific or technical goals within broad outlines provided by top management.
Minimum Education & Experience Required
Must have Master’s degree or equivalent in Robotics, Machine Learning, Computer Engineering, or a related field plus 5 years of experience in the offered role or related.
Must have 5 years of experience with : linear algebra; sensor calibration techniques for robotics and autonomous systems;
and Linux based systems.
Must have 3 years of experience with : machine learning methods; Python; and robot operating systems.
Must have some experience with : optimization techniques; gradient descent; lidar and stereo camera based point clouds; Kalman filters;
particle filters; articulated robots and manipulators; C++; AWS and Google cloud; and statistical methods for precision and recall.
